Coleton Fishacre Garden


Coleton Fishacre Garden is delightful, with its formal terraces. A cultured oasis on the beautiful south Devon coast, with the stream gurgling from pool to pool through generous marginal plantings. The valley garden weaves down towards the sea, with contrasting moods and year-round colour including rhododendrons, camellias, mimosas and tender southern hemisphere trees and shrubs. Water features, gazebo and a thriving collection of rare and exotic plants from around the world can also be found.
